8 1/2 birthdays that can affect your finances

By LIZ WESTON
NerdWallet

You hit a lot of milestone birthdays when you're young. There's your first birthday, of course, and also the one where you turn 10 (finally, double digits!). At 13, you're a teenager. At 16, you're probably thinking about driving. At 18, you can vote; at 21, you can get into bars.

You hit a bunch of milestones later in life as well, and many of them have to do with retirement. Knowing these age milestones can help you better prepare for life after work. They include:
